TONIGHT: RAYS VS. PADRES

TONIGHT: RAYS VS. PADRES

WHEN/WHERE: 7:15; Tropicana Field, St. Petersburg.

TV/RADIO: Ch. 32; WFLA-AM 970. PITCHERS: Padres -- RHP Brian Lawrence (5-3, 3.54); Rays -- RHP Ryan Rupe (5-6, 4.85).

WORTH NOTING: Rupe is 2-1 with a 2.57 ERA in his past three starts. He has the seventh-best strikeout to walk ratio in the American League (54-16) and is ninth with a .230 batting average against and fewest walks per nine innings (2.1). ... Lawrence allowed three runs on seven hits in 71/3 innings against the Brewers on June 1. He struck out a career-high 10.

OUTTA LEFTFIELD

Details of the team meeting manager Hal McRae called before Wednesday's game were hard to come by. But McRae did offer this Thursday: "I did the majority of the talking. Milt (May, hitting coach) did talk a little bit. Players were invited to talk. I mentioned that to captain (Greg) Vaughn and he turned it over to the young captain (Brent Abernathy). We got a big kick out of that."
